dc.description.abstract | South African judicial officers have adopted, but only to an extent, the concept of restorative justice (A Skelton and M Batley 'Restorative justice: a contemporary South African review' 2008 Acta Criminologica 42, 49; cf SS Terblanche Guide to sentencing in South Africa (2007) 177 and S v Maluleke 2008 (1) SACR 49 (T)). This aims to hold offenders accountable in a meaningful way while addressing the needs of victims and the larger community. | |
